Making matters even worse for Mizzou was the fact that the Tigers were decimated by injuries during the game. Already playing without the services of starting RG Alec Abeln (out w/ankle sprain), senior CB John Gibson was lost on the first defensive snap of the game to a sprained knee. Later, on the same series, senior WLB and team leader Michael Scherer was also knocked out of the game with a sprained knee. Starting TE Jason Reese had to leave the game in the first quarter with bruised ribs as well, and then in the fourth quarter, sophomore DT Terry Beckner, Jr., also left the game with a sprained knee.
